Is it permissible for two individuals who helped an expatriate in his court case to take a percentage of the financial amount awarded to the expatriate, whether the expatriate knows about it or not?

They are not permitted to take anything from the victim's right (due to him) without his permission and consent. If he is mentally incapacitated, then the consent of his guardian is necessary. His guardian is not permitted to donate any of his money. If they are entitled to something by agreement or custom, then they should take it through lawful means. However, taking his money without the knowledge and consent of whoever's consent is considered valid is impermissible.
